What they do
A Janitor or Cleaner provides cleaning and basic maintenance in buildings such as schools, offices, stores, hospitals or hotels. Cleans and polishes floors, removes trash, vacuums carpets, washes windows, cleans bathrooms, stocks building supplies such as light bulbs and paper towels and performs minor repairs as needed. Holds keys for rooms and building entrances and locks or unlocks them as needed.

03/22/2023 Primary Function Wor-Wic Community College continuously accepts applications to fill Building Attendant positions to perform custodial duties in campus buildings. These positions are considered "essential employees" and as such, may be required to report during non-scheduled days, evenings, weekends and/or holidays to assist with snow removal and other work situations. We are currently filling the following vacancies: Full-Time Building Attendant (Night Shift) 11pm- 7am Essential Duties The following list is not intended as, nor should it be construed as, exhaustive of all responsibilities, skills or working conditions associated with this position.
